Fairview Homes, Greensboro, NC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Fairview Homes?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Fairview Homes 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,243 | $925 | $1,500 |
Fairview Homes 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,660 | $1,250 | $2,400 |
Fairview Homes 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,123 | $1,800 | $2,415 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Fairview Homes
What type of rentals are currently available in Fairview Homes?
There are currently 128 Apartments for Rent in Fairview Homes, NC with pricing that ranges from $605 to $2,531. There are also 31 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Fairview Homes ranging from $925 to $2,415.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Fairview Homes?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Fairview Homes ranges from $925 to $2,415 with an average monthly rent of $1,630.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Fairview Homes?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Fairview Homes range from $605 to $2,531,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,250 to $2,400.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,800 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,400.
